maskn.

1.a covering for part or all of the face, worn to hide or protect it

a gas/surgical mask

The robbers wore stocking masks.

2.something that covers your face and has another face painted on it

The kids were all wearing animal masks.

3.a thick cream made of various substances that you put on your face and neck in order to improve the quality of your skin

a face mask

4.[ususing]a manner or an expression that hides your true character or feelings

He longed to throw off the mask of respectability.

Her face was a cold blank mask.

v.

1.~ sthto hide a feeling, smell, fact, etc. so that it cannot be easily seen or noticed

She masked her anger with a smile.

n.1.something that you wear to cover part or all of your face in order to protect it from something harmful such as poisonous gas, bacteria, or smoke; something that you wear to cover part or all of your face in order to hide who you are or for decoration2.an expression on someones face that hides their true feelings, thoughts, or character3.a wet substance used for cleaning your skin that you put on your face and allow to dry before removing it

v.1.to cover something in order to hide it2.to hide the smell, taste, or sound of something with a stronger smell or taste or a louder sound3.to hide your true feelings, thoughts, or character
